What is the typical protein content in a 100-gram serving of amberjack?

Answer

Around 20 grams of protein

A standard reference serving size for nutritional analysis, typically cited as 100 grams or 3.5 ounces, provides a significant amount of high-quality protein from amberjack. This figure, approximately 20 grams per serving, highlights its value for essential bodily functions, particularly muscle maintenance. High protein intake contributes substantially to satiety, helping individuals feel full longer after a meal, which can be beneficial for overall dietary management. This substantial protein load, combined with moderate caloric density, makes it a compelling component of a diet focused on nutrient density.
